TH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, Respondent, v. KEANNU SPENCER, Appellant.


Unpublished Opinion

MOTION DECISION

DECISION AND ORDER ON MOTION

By order dated June 30, 2021, assigned counsel, Jacob A. Vredenburgh, Esq., was granted an extension of time to perfect this appeal until September 20, 2021. The order noted that no further extensions would be granted absent an unanticipated excuse for the delay. Counsel has failed to perfect the appeal or seek a further extension of time to do so.

Now, therefore, upon the Court's own motion, it is

ORDERED that in the event the appeal is not perfected on or before September 26, 2022, Jacob A. Vredenburgh Esq., may be relieved of this assignment and new counsel assigned.

Garry, P.J., Egan Jr., Clark and Pritzker, JJ., concur.
